Understanding Personalised Mind-Tracking

Traditional mental health assessments often rely on self-report questionnaires or clinical interviews, which, while valuable, can be subjective and limited in scope. By contrast, modern technologies leverage sensors, AI algorithms, and real-time data analytics to provide a detailed portrait of mental activity. This fusion of hardware and software fuels a new era of cognitive self-awareness, where individuals can explore their mental landscape proactively and sustainably.
